Design Performance and Practicality

One of the most important aspects of any machine embroidery design is how it translates into a finished product. Here’s what I found particularly useful about Dandelion Seed Head:
  1. Glance-Friendly Appeal: The shape of the dandelion seed head is easily recognizable at a glance, which is crucial for attracting attention in a crowded booth. Its simple silhouette allows it to stand out against various fabric textures and colors.
  2. Scalability: While it performs best as a medium-sized design, it can work as a small accent when placed strategically. However, avoid shrinking it too much; the tiny details may lose clarity, especially if using fine threads.
  3. Photography Potential: This design photographs exceptionally well, thanks to its three-dimensional texture and soft edges. For Etsy sellers or digital creators, it’s a strong candidate for printable mockups and social media previews.
  4. Batch Production Readiness: The stitch pattern is consistent and repeatable, which means you can confidently produce multiple units for your booth. Just ensure you test each placement carefully to maintain uniformity across all products.

Visual Appeal and Customer Engagement

In a sea of embroidered flowers, the Dandelion Seed Head stands out by being understated yet memorable. It doesn’t shout for attention but invites a closer look, which is vital for engaging potential buyers at a craft fair. The design’s natural, almost ethereal look pairs well with other botanical elements or minimalist text, helping create cohesive collections that speak to brand identity. As a single flower in the Single Flowers Plants category, it offers flexibility for boutique makers looking to mix and match with other embroidery files. Whether used alone or grouped with similar plant motifs, it maintains a level of sophistication that appeals to both casual shoppers and serious collectors of handmade goods.
